Mobility

A folding scooter can be ideal for those who travel. They can fold easily to fit into the trunk of a car or even under the seat of public transportation. They are also lightweight and are smaller than traditional mobility scooters. A folding mobility scooter can help you travel wherever you want, whether traveling upcountry or abroad.

To choose the right scooter, you should first assess your lifestyle and needs. Discuss your needs with mobility experts or healthcare experts to help you make the right decision. They can guide you on the different options available for both foldable and non-folding scooters.

Once you've chosen the kind of scooter that's right for you, consider the size of the scooter and other features. You'll be required to know the overall dimensions, height, and width of the scooter, as well as the top speed. These factors are important because they determine how much space you'll require for storage and transportation.

Furthermore, be aware that the majority of mobility scooters that fold can only be designed to fit a certain weight capacity. If you plan to travel with a heavier person it is recommended to choose an option with a larger capacity for weight.

Depending on the way you'll use your mobility scooter, you should be aware of the armrest options. Some models have folding armrests and others have fixed armrests. If you plan to use your scooter for outdoor activities, then you should also consider its tire size. Solid tires are used on the majority of folding mobility scooters, which might be lighter, but less comfortable than air-filled tires.

Another thing to take into consideration when purchasing a folding mobility scooter is the battery life and range. If you plan to travel further distances, then you'll need a model with a large battery. The average battery should last for about six months before it needs to be replaced.

Last but not last, you should consider the price of the scooter. Some mobility scooters that fold cost more than others. You'll want to make sure that the scooter you select is covered by your insurance company.

Safety

If you are buying a folding model, ensure that it comes with the same safety features that you would expect from a full-sized scooter. Included in this list are brake-responsive taillights, high-mounted rear lights, and a charging system that shuts down after three hours. Make sure you have a loud enough horn to be heard by cars passing. This is essential, particularly when you're on a busy street. If you want to travel fast, choose an electric scooter that can reach speeds that exceed 20 mph.





A good folding scooter must include wheels as well as an erect frame. This will help you stay in control, and avoid falling off. It should have an extra safety strap to provide security. It should also be simple to put together, and it should be locked when not in use. A U-lock is recommended for your scooter since it is more secure than a cable or chain lock. Use a U lock with care as it is more difficult to cut than other locks. You should also try to keep your scooter inside whenever possible, as it can be damaged by water.

Even if you're riding a scooter for a short distance, it is important to wear helmets. There are serious injuries that can result when you fall off a scooter. In fact, 96% of those injured in a recent UCLA study were not wearing helmets. It's important to purchase an CPSC-certified helmet or one that complies with the same safety standards like bike helmets or downhill mountain biking helmets.
